Meet Our Keynote Speaker: Dr. Gulshan Harjee
We are honored to welcome Dr. Gulshan Harjee as the keynote speaker for She Rises: A Night of Courage & Compassion. Dr. Harjee’s extraordinary journey is one of resilience, faith, and unyielding compassion. Expelled from her homeland of Tanzania, she survived war in Pakistan, the Iranian Revolution, cancer, and even a fatal bus crash—where she rescued others from the wreckage. She has endured the unimaginable: the loss of a spouse to gun violence and the trials of single parenthood. Despite life’s tragedies, Dr. Harjee rose to become a physician, humanitarian, and fierce community advocate. A graduate of Morehouse School of Medicine, she built a 30-year career in DeKalb County. She founded the Mosaic Health Center in Clarkston—offering free, comprehensive care to thousands of vulnerable patients.
